Search

S. T. John Courtenay Iii

Examiner (ID: 6937)

Most Active Art Unit
2126
Art Unit(s)
2126, 3992, 2194, 2755, 2316, 2151
Total Applications
622
Issued Applications
509
Pending Applications
45
Abandoned Applications
68

Applications

Application numberTitle of the applicationFiling DateStatus
Array ( [id] => 1557441 [patent_doc_number] => 06401146 [patent_country] => US [patent_kind] => B1 [patent_issue_date] => 2002-06-04 [patent_title] => 'Device and method for controlling PCI ethernet' [patent_app_type] => B1 [patent_app_number] => 09/138554 [patent_app_country] => US [patent_app_date] => 1998-08-24 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 5 [patent_figures_cnt] => 5 [patent_no_of_words] => 3099 [patent_no_of_claims] => 13 [patent_no_of_ind_claims] => 3 [patent_words_short_claim] => 127 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/401/06401146.pdf [firstpage_image] =>[orig_patent_app_number] => 09138554 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/138554
Device and method for controlling PCI ethernet Aug 23, 1998 Issued
09/138427 METHOD AND SYSTEM FOR PERFORMING REAL-TIME INTER-PROCESS COMMUNICATION Aug 23, 1998 Abandoned
Array ( [id] => 1429432 [patent_doc_number] => 06510452 [patent_country] => US [patent_kind] => B1 [patent_issue_date] => 2003-01-21 [patent_title] => 'System and method for communications management with a network presence icon' [patent_app_type] => B1 [patent_app_number] => 09/137687 [patent_app_country] => US [patent_app_date] => 1998-08-21 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 12 [patent_figures_cnt] => 12 [patent_no_of_words] => 3604 [patent_no_of_claims] => 31 [patent_no_of_ind_claims] => 6 [patent_words_short_claim] => 63 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/510/06510452.pdf [firstpage_image] =>[orig_patent_app_number] => 09137687 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/137687
System and method for communications management with a network presence icon Aug 20, 1998 Issued
Array ( [id] => 7645963 [patent_doc_number] => 06477559 [patent_country] => US [patent_kind] => B1 [patent_issue_date] => 2002-11-05 [patent_title] => 'Method and apparatus for remotely accessing an automatic transaction processing system' [patent_app_type] => B1 [patent_app_number] => 09/137973 [patent_app_country] => US [patent_app_date] => 1998-08-21 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 6 [patent_figures_cnt] => 6 [patent_no_of_words] => 5466 [patent_no_of_claims] => 22 [patent_no_of_ind_claims] => 3 [patent_words_short_claim] => 6 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/477/06477559.pdf [firstpage_image] =>[orig_patent_app_number] => 09137973 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/137973
Method and apparatus for remotely accessing an automatic transaction processing system Aug 20, 1998 Issued
Array ( [id] => 1580164 [patent_doc_number] => 06470385 [patent_country] => US [patent_kind] => B1 [patent_issue_date] => 2002-10-22 [patent_title] => 'Network monitoring system, monitored controller, and monitoring controller' [patent_app_type] => B1 [patent_app_number] => 09/137642 [patent_app_country] => US [patent_app_date] => 1998-08-20 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 17 [patent_figures_cnt] => 18 [patent_no_of_words] => 6597 [patent_no_of_claims] => 15 [patent_no_of_ind_claims] => 3 [patent_words_short_claim] => 74 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/470/06470385.pdf [firstpage_image] =>[orig_patent_app_number] => 09137642 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/137642
Network monitoring system, monitored controller, and monitoring controller Aug 19, 1998 Issued
Array ( [id] => 1538990 [patent_doc_number] => 06412018 [patent_country] => US [patent_kind] => B1 [patent_issue_date] => 2002-06-25 [patent_title] => 'System for handling asynchronous message packet in a multi-node threaded computing environment' [patent_app_type] => B1 [patent_app_number] => 09/136388 [patent_app_country] => US [patent_app_date] => 1998-08-19 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 3 [patent_figures_cnt] => 3 [patent_no_of_words] => 4462 [patent_no_of_claims] => 11 [patent_no_of_ind_claims] => 2 [patent_words_short_claim] => 129 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/412/06412018.pdf [firstpage_image] =>[orig_patent_app_number] => 09136388 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/136388
System for handling asynchronous message packet in a multi-node threaded computing environment Aug 18, 1998 Issued
Array ( [id] => 1601886 [patent_doc_number] => 06385659 [patent_country] => US [patent_kind] => B1 [patent_issue_date] => 2002-05-07 [patent_title] => 'Handling of asynchronous message packet in a multi-node threaded computing environment' [patent_app_type] => B1 [patent_app_number] => 09/136587 [patent_app_country] => US [patent_app_date] => 1998-08-19 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 3 [patent_figures_cnt] => 3 [patent_no_of_words] => 4361 [patent_no_of_claims] => 10 [patent_no_of_ind_claims] => 1 [patent_words_short_claim] => 177 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/385/06385659.pdf [firstpage_image] =>[orig_patent_app_number] => 09136587 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/136587
Handling of asynchronous message packet in a multi-node threaded computing environment Aug 18, 1998 Issued
Array ( [id] => 1524796 [patent_doc_number] => 06415332 [patent_country] => US [patent_kind] => B1 [patent_issue_date] => 2002-07-02 [patent_title] => 'Method for handling of asynchronous message packet in a multi-node threaded computing environment' [patent_app_type] => B1 [patent_app_number] => 09/136692 [patent_app_country] => US [patent_app_date] => 1998-08-19 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 3 [patent_figures_cnt] => 3 [patent_no_of_words] => 4318 [patent_no_of_claims] => 10 [patent_no_of_ind_claims] => 1 [patent_words_short_claim] => 125 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/415/06415332.pdf [firstpage_image] =>[orig_patent_app_number] => 09136692 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/136692
Method for handling of asynchronous message packet in a multi-node threaded computing environment Aug 18, 1998 Issued
Array ( [id] => 1337331 [patent_doc_number] => 06604196 [patent_country] => US [patent_kind] => B1 [patent_issue_date] => 2003-08-05 [patent_title] => 'Apparatus and method for component role fulfillment based on environment context' [patent_app_type] => B1 [patent_app_number] => 09/135679 [patent_app_country] => US [patent_app_date] => 1998-08-18 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 5 [patent_figures_cnt] => 5 [patent_no_of_words] => 11386 [patent_no_of_claims] => 56 [patent_no_of_ind_claims] => 5 [patent_words_short_claim] => 96 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/604/06604196.pdf [firstpage_image] =>[orig_patent_app_number] => 09135679 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/135679
Apparatus and method for component role fulfillment based on environment context Aug 17, 1998 Issued
Array ( [id] => 1513147 [patent_doc_number] => 06442620 [patent_country] => US [patent_kind] => B1 [patent_issue_date] => 2002-08-27 [patent_title] => 'Environment extensibility and automatic services for component applications using contexts, policies and activators' [patent_app_type] => B1 [patent_app_number] => 09/135397 [patent_app_country] => US [patent_app_date] => 1998-08-17 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 19 [patent_figures_cnt] => 21 [patent_no_of_words] => 15763 [patent_no_of_claims] => 25 [patent_no_of_ind_claims] => 9 [patent_words_short_claim] => 110 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/442/06442620.pdf [firstpage_image] =>[orig_patent_app_number] => 09135397 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/135397
Environment extensibility and automatic services for component applications using contexts, policies and activators Aug 16, 1998 Issued
Array ( [id] => 1587260 [patent_doc_number] => 06425017 [patent_country] => US [patent_kind] => B1 [patent_issue_date] => 2002-07-23 [patent_title] => 'Queued method invocations on distributed component applications' [patent_app_type] => B1 [patent_app_number] => 09/135378 [patent_app_country] => US [patent_app_date] => 1998-08-17 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 7 [patent_figures_cnt] => 10 [patent_no_of_words] => 12089 [patent_no_of_claims] => 14 [patent_no_of_ind_claims] => 8 [patent_words_short_claim] => 104 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/425/06425017.pdf [firstpage_image] =>[orig_patent_app_number] => 09135378 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/135378
Queued method invocations on distributed component applications Aug 16, 1998 Issued
Array ( [id] => 1567175 [patent_doc_number] => 06438621 [patent_country] => US [patent_kind] => B1 [patent_issue_date] => 2002-08-20 [patent_title] => 'In-memory modification of computer programs' [patent_app_type] => B1 [patent_app_number] => 09/133981 [patent_app_country] => US [patent_app_date] => 1998-08-14 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 27 [patent_figures_cnt] => 27 [patent_no_of_words] => 9506 [patent_no_of_claims] => 24 [patent_no_of_ind_claims] => 6 [patent_words_short_claim] => 71 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/438/06438621.pdf [firstpage_image] =>[orig_patent_app_number] => 09133981 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/133981
In-memory modification of computer programs Aug 13, 1998 Issued
Array ( [id] => 1428732 [patent_doc_number] => 06513071 [patent_country] => US [patent_kind] => B2 [patent_issue_date] => 2003-01-28 [patent_title] => 'Method for providing kiosk functionality in a general purpose operating system' [patent_app_type] => B2 [patent_app_number] => 09/133520 [patent_app_country] => US [patent_app_date] => 1998-08-13 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 9 [patent_figures_cnt] => 10 [patent_no_of_words] => 2757 [patent_no_of_claims] => 24 [patent_no_of_ind_claims] => 3 [patent_words_short_claim] => 178 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/513/06513071.pdf [firstpage_image] =>[orig_patent_app_number] => 09133520 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/133520
Method for providing kiosk functionality in a general purpose operating system Aug 12, 1998 Issued
Array ( [id] => 4351241 [patent_doc_number] => 06314459 [patent_country] => US [patent_kind] => NA [patent_issue_date] => 2001-11-06 [patent_title] => 'Home-network autoconfiguration' [patent_app_type] => 1 [patent_app_number] => 9/133622 [patent_app_country] => US [patent_app_date] => 1998-08-13 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 7 [patent_figures_cnt] => 7 [patent_no_of_words] => 2924 [patent_no_of_claims] => 18 [patent_no_of_ind_claims] => 6 [patent_words_short_claim] => 81 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/314/06314459.pdf [firstpage_image] =>[orig_patent_app_number] => 133622 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/133622
Home-network autoconfiguration Aug 12, 1998 Issued
Array ( [id] => 1484861 [patent_doc_number] => 06453362 [patent_country] => US [patent_kind] => B1 [patent_issue_date] => 2002-09-17 [patent_title] => 'Systems, methods and computer program products for invoking server applications using tickets registered in client-side remote object registries' [patent_app_type] => B1 [patent_app_number] => 09/132969 [patent_app_country] => US [patent_app_date] => 1998-08-12 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 4 [patent_figures_cnt] => 4 [patent_no_of_words] => 4360 [patent_no_of_claims] => 36 [patent_no_of_ind_claims] => 9 [patent_words_short_claim] => 103 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/453/06453362.pdf [firstpage_image] =>[orig_patent_app_number] => 09132969 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/132969
Systems, methods and computer program products for invoking server applications using tickets registered in client-side remote object registries Aug 11, 1998 Issued
Array ( [id] => 1567485 [patent_doc_number] => 06438678 [patent_country] => US [patent_kind] => B1 [patent_issue_date] => 2002-08-20 [patent_title] => 'Apparatus and method for operating on data in a data communications system' [patent_app_type] => B1 [patent_app_number] => 09/132621 [patent_app_country] => US [patent_app_date] => 1998-08-11 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 16 [patent_figures_cnt] => 16 [patent_no_of_words] => 10789 [patent_no_of_claims] => 53 [patent_no_of_ind_claims] => 5 [patent_words_short_claim] => 63 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/438/06438678.pdf [firstpage_image] =>[orig_patent_app_number] => 09132621 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/132621
Apparatus and method for operating on data in a data communications system Aug 10, 1998 Issued
Array ( [id] => 1557782 [patent_doc_number] => 06401240 [patent_country] => US [patent_kind] => B1 [patent_issue_date] => 2002-06-04 [patent_title] => 'System and method for profiling code on symmetric multiprocessor architectures' [patent_app_type] => B1 [patent_app_number] => 09/130761 [patent_app_country] => US [patent_app_date] => 1998-08-07 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 5 [patent_figures_cnt] => 6 [patent_no_of_words] => 4961 [patent_no_of_claims] => 20 [patent_no_of_ind_claims] => 3 [patent_words_short_claim] => 93 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/401/06401240.pdf [firstpage_image] =>[orig_patent_app_number] => 09130761 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/130761
System and method for profiling code on symmetric multiprocessor architectures Aug 6, 1998 Issued
Array ( [id] => 1430178 [patent_doc_number] => 06526455 [patent_country] => US [patent_kind] => B1 [patent_issue_date] => 2003-02-25 [patent_title] => 'Object management method, apparatus and data structure' [patent_app_type] => B1 [patent_app_number] => 09/117669 [patent_app_country] => US [patent_app_date] => 1998-08-04 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 31 [patent_figures_cnt] => 35 [patent_no_of_words] => 22908 [patent_no_of_claims] => 6 [patent_no_of_ind_claims] => 6 [patent_words_short_claim] => 194 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/526/06526455.pdf [firstpage_image] =>[orig_patent_app_number] => 09117669 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/117669
Object management method, apparatus and data structure Aug 3, 1998 Issued
09/129467 APPARATUS AND METHOD FOR FORMING A PACKAGED-OBJECT PRODUCT AND A PACKAGED-OBJECT PRODUCT FORMED THEREFROM Aug 3, 1998 Abandoned
Array ( [id] => 4351048 [patent_doc_number] => 06314445 [patent_country] => US [patent_kind] => NA [patent_issue_date] => 2001-11-06 [patent_title] => 'Native function calling' [patent_app_type] => 1 [patent_app_number] => 9/128082 [patent_app_country] => US [patent_app_date] => 1998-08-03 [patent_effective_date] => 0000-00-00 [patent_drawing_sheets_cnt] => 7 [patent_figures_cnt] => 11 [patent_no_of_words] => 4405 [patent_no_of_claims] => 10 [patent_no_of_ind_claims] => 2 [patent_words_short_claim] => 93 [patent_maintenance] => 1 [patent_no_of_assignments] => 0 [patent_current_assignee] =>[type] => patent [pdf_file] => patents/06/314/06314445.pdf [firstpage_image] =>[orig_patent_app_number] => 128082 [rel_patent_id] =>[rel_patent_doc_number] =>)
09/128082
Native function calling Aug 2, 1998 Issued
Menu